Alcoholism Is Influenced By Both Environmental And Genetic Elements

Alcohol addiction is affected by both environmental and genetic elements. Dependencies, particularly dependencies to alcohol tend to run in family groups and it is understood that genes contribute because process. Research has shown in recent years that people who have/had alcoholic parents are far more likely to suffer from the same disorder themselves. Oddly, males have a higher tendency to alcoholism in this situation than females.

Individuals with diminished inhibitions are at an even greater chance for developing into alcoholics. If an individual comes from a family with one or more alcoholics and loves to take risks, they should recognize that they are at what is considered high likelihood for turning into an alcoholic.

Recent academic works have determined that genetics performs an essential role in the advancement of alcohol addiction but the familial pathways or specific genes to dependency have not been discovered. At this time, it is believed that the inherited tendency toward alcohol addiction in a person does not guarantee that he or she will develop into an alcoholic but instead simply means that those individuals feel the results of the alcohol more powerfully and quickly. In effect, the decision of genetic risk is only a determination of higher chance toward the dependency and not necessarily a sign of future alcoholism.

There was a gene discovered in 1990 called the DRD2 gene. This is the very first gene that has proven to have any link towards affecting the outcome of alcoholism in humans. Once more, considering the method this particular gene works, the person with the DRD2 gene would be thought to have a higher pull towards the effects of alcohol compared to somebody without the gene but having DRD2 does not ensure alcohol addiction in the individual.

The immediate desire to find a gene accountable for alcoholism is due in part to the pressing need to help determine people who are at high chance when they are children. If this can be discovered at an early age and kids raised to understand that taking that initial drink for them might possibly send them down the roadway to alcohol addiction, it may cut down on the number of alcoholics in the future.

Despite a hereditary predilection toward alcoholism, it is still a conscious choice to choose to consume alcohol and to get drunk. It has been stated that the person with the hereditary predisposition to alcoholism is an alcoholic at birth whether she or he ever takes a drink. Taking the drink initiates the condition into its active stage. The ability to stop drinking prior to becoming addicted rests , in the end, in the hands of the drinker.
